Act's David Seymour couldn't resist setting out what those arguments might be about, but didn't make them, just yet.ĭeputy Prime Minister Carmel Sepuloni thanked other parties for their "graciousness" in their speeches to the Government's statement in the House on the shooting. They explicitly put political arguments over law and order aside for another day. The Prime Minister, Leader of the Opposition and party leaders in the House concentrated, correctly, on condolences to those who had lost family in the double killing and shooting of seven others. Raw Politics examines how our political leaders responded to the highly public tragedy in central Auckland and how long they will be able to refrain from arguing about blame and recriminations. This week on the Raw Politics podcast: Politics is briefly put aside as leaders respond to the Auckland shooting tragedy Plus Labour's law and order policy deluge and who might next lead Labour and National.
